The Laboratory

The laboratory serves as the sacred space where alchemists conduct their experiments and delve into the mysteries of transformation. It is a dedicated environment designed to facilitate the alchemist’s work and ensure accurate and consistent results.

There are several key components that make up an alchemical laboratory:

  • Workstation: A sturdy table or bench where experiments are performed.
  • Storage Cabinets: To organize and store various chemicals, materials, and equipment safely.
  • Safety Equipment: Gloves, lab coats, goggles, and fire extinguishers to ensure the alchemist’s safety.

Glassware

Glassware is a fundamental component of any alchemist’s toolkit. It is chosen for its transparency, chemical resistance, and ease of cleaning. The most common types of glassware used in alchemy include:

Glassware Functions
Beakers Used for holding, mixing, and heating liquids.
Flasks Utilized for containing and heating liquids. The round-bottom flask is commonly used in distillation.
Test Tubes Small cylindrical vessels for conducting experiments on small quantities of substances.
Pipettes and Burettes Precise measuring tools for transferring small amounts of liquid.

Glassware is often labeled with volume graduations, allowing alchemists to measure and track the amounts of substances accurately. It is crucial for consistent and replicable experimentation.

Heating Devices

Heat is an essential element in alchemical processes, enabling the transformation of substances. Alchemists utilize various heating devices to control temperature accurately and apply heat to their experiments. The most common heating devices include:

  • Bunsen Burner: A gas burner that produces an adjustable flame for heating.
  • Laboratory Hot Plate: A flat, electrically powered surface with temperature controls for uniform heating.
  • Sand Baths and Oil Baths: Used to heat substances indirectly for delicate processes.

It is crucial for alchemists to choose heating devices suitable for their specific experiments, ensuring safety and optimal results.

Distillation Equipment

Distillation is a widely used process in alchemy, separating liquids based on their boiling points. Distillation equipment allows alchemists to purify substances, extract desired components, and create new compounds. The primary components of distillation equipment include:

  • Alembics: Essential vessels used for distillation, consisting of a boiling flask, condenser, and receiver.
  • Condensers: Devices that cool and convert vapor back into a liquid state.
  • Receivers: Containers used to collect the distilled liquid.

Distillation is a complex process, requiring precision and careful control of temperature. The quality of the distillation equipment greatly influences the success and purity of the final product.

Mortar and Pestle

The mortar and pestle have been used since ancient times and remain invaluable tools in alchemy. The mortar is a sturdy bowl made of materials like glass, ceramic, or stone, while the pestle is a handheld tool used to grind, crush, or mix substances within the mortar.

Mortar and pestle come in various sizes, allowing alchemists to work with different quantities of substances. They are essential for preparing powdered materials, combining components, and creating homogenous mixtures.

Filtration Equipment

Filtration is a critical process in alchemy, separating mixtures into their individual components based on various properties such as particle size or solubility. Filtration equipment ensures the removal of solid particles from liquids or gases and consists of the following components:

  • Filter Funnel: A conical funnel used to hold the filter paper and collect the filtrate.
  • Filter Flask: Connected to the filter funnel, this flask captures the filtered liquid.
  • Filter Paper: Placed inside the filter funnel, it traps solid particles while allowing the liquid to pass through.

Filtration equipment is crucial for purifying substances, removing impurities, and obtaining clean solutions for further experiments.
